HIV breaks down our body’s immune system. It is the infection that causes acquired immune deficiency syndrome (AIDS), the most advanced stage of HIV disease. You cannot know for sure if you have HIV until you get tested, so testing is very important!

Who should be tested?
It is recommended that the following people who face a higher risk be tested:-
- Drug addicts who inject drugs and have been sharing needles or syringes
- Use of unprotected blood products or transfusion with infected blood
- Healthcare peoples who take blood without precautions
- Prisoners
- Prostitutes
- People with sexually transmitted diseases (STD)
- Men and women with more than one sex partners
- Unprotected sex with infected persons
- The person who realizes, having been in contact with any of the objects, which spreads HIV.
Test Procedure
Before the test please read the instruction manual. Keep the test strip and the specimen back to room temperature to 20- 30 ℃. If not ready, do not tear foil bag, kits without the package shall be used within 1 hour (20%- 90% humidity)
1. Remove the cassette from the foil bag , take out all the accessory to be used.
2. Open the Alcohol Pad . Use the Alcohol Pad to disinfect the finger. (Note: Before collection make sure the finger is clean and dry).
3. Open a lancet and prick the fingertip, collect blood.
4. Draw the fingertips blood specimen with pipette .
5. Drip one drop of blood specimen to the S well.
6. And meanwhile add 4 drops of diluent into the D well with pipette.
7. Wait for 15-20 minutes and read results. Over 20 min, the result is invalid.
Results Judgment
The TEST LINE – which appears closer to the bottom of the test strip (below the control line) indicates the presence of HIV specific antibodies. The test line will become visible within 15 minutes after starting a valid test when HIV specific antibodies are present at detectable levels in the specimen.
REACTIVE / Positive
(diagram 1):
Two pink/purple lines, one in the TEST area and one in the CONTROL area indicate a REACTIVE Test Result. The line in the TEST area may look different from the line in the CONTROL area. Intensities of the Test and Control Lines may vary. Test Result with visible lines in both TEST and CONTROL areas, regardless of intensity, is considered REACTIVE. A REACTIVE Test Result means that HIV-1 and/or HIV-2 antibodies have been detected in the specimen. The Test Result is interpreted as Preliminary POSITIVE for HIV-1 and/or HIV-2 antibodies.
NONREACTIVE / Negative
(diagram 2):
One pink/purple line in the CONTROL area, with no line in the TEST area indicates a NONREACTIVE Test Result. A NONREACTIVE Test Result means that HIV-1 and HIV-2 antibodies were not detected in the specimen.The Test Result is interpreted as NEGATIVE for HIV-1 and HIV-2 antibodies.
INVALID
(diagram 3):
A pink/purple line should always appear in the CONTROL area, whether or not a line appears in the
TEST area. If there is no distinct pink/purple line visible in the CONTROL area (see diagrams 3), then the test is INVALID. An INVALID test cannot be interpreted. It is recommended that the INVALID test be repeated with a new device.
